Course Details

Fundamentals of Crop Price Forecasting: An introduction to the key concepts, methods, and tools used in crop price forecasting. This unit will cover topics such as data analysis, statistical modeling, and market trends.
Market Analysis for Crop Prices: This unit will delve into the various factors that influence crop prices, including supply and demand, weather patterns, and geopolitical events. Students will learn how to analyze market data to identify trends and make informed predictions.
Data Analysis for Crop Price Forecasting: In this unit, students will learn how to collect, clean, and analyze data relevant to crop price forecasting. This will include techniques such as time series analysis, regression analysis, and machine learning.
Statistical Modeling for Crop Prices: Students will learn how to build and implement statistical models to forecast crop prices. This will include an overview of different modeling techniques, such as linear regression, ARIMA, and machine learning algorithms.
Machine Learning for Crop Price Forecasting: This unit will cover the use of machine learning algorithms in crop price forecasting. Students will learn how to train and implement machine learning models, as well as how to evaluate their performance.
Risk Management in Crop Price Forecasting: This unit will explore the various risks associated with crop price forecasting and how to manage them. Topics will include market volatility, data uncertainty, and model risk.
Advanced Techniques in Crop Price Forecasting: In this final unit, students will learn about cutting-edge techniques and tools used in crop price forecasting. This may include topics such as big data analysis, real-time data processing, and advanced machine learning algorithms.


Career Path

Roles and opportunities in the crop price forecasting and market analysis sector are on the rise, making our Masterclass Certificate more relevant than ever. Here's a peek at the landscape: 1. **Agricultural Data Analyst**: Crunching numbers and interpreting data is vital for predicting crop prices. These professionals earn £30,000 to £50,000 annually in the UK. 2. **Crop Economist**: Combining agricultural knowledge with economic principles, they study crop market trends, earning £35,000 to £60,000. 3. **Market Research Analyst**: Specialized in the agricultural sector, they study market conditions and trends, earning £25,000 to £50,000. 4. **Agricultural Statistician**: Expertise in data collection, analysis, and interpretation, they earn £25,000 to £55,000. 5. **Crop Price Forecaster**: With in-depth knowledge of crop prices and market trends, they earn £30,000 to £60,000. These roles emphasize the increasing demand for professionals skilled in crop price forecasting and market analysis.
